Dr. Zahm was born and raised in Lancaster County. He attended Hempfield High School and graduated in 2001. From there, Dr. Zahm attended Ohio Wesleyan University where he played on the men’s varsity soccer team. It was midway through his freshman year that Dr. Zahm decided on a career in dentistry and made the tough decision to transfer and continue his undergraduate coursework at Ohio State University. Dr. Zahm then attended Temple University School of Dentistry and attained his DMD in 2009.
Dr. Zahm began his professional career as an associate in Elizabethtown and moved on to assist in opening a practice for his employer in Manheim, Pa. It was shortly after this that Dr. Zahm met Dr. Hoffman, of Brockie Dental, and knew that he wanted Brockie Dental to be his dental home and acquired the practice in April of 2013.
Throughout his time at Brockie Dental, Dr. Zahm has been educated through advanced Continuing Education courses on the current techniques for Implant placement, Orthodontic treatment with Invisalign, and Full Mouth Rehabilitation.
